Analysis

In 2023, daily per capita fat supply vs. gdp per capita in South Africa stood at 95.57 grams of fat per day per capita.

That represents a change of down 4.1% on the previous year and up 8.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, daily per capita fat supply vs. gdp per capita in South Africa peaked at 99.65 grams of fat per day per capita in 2022 and was at its lowest, 59.14 grams of fat per day per capita, in 1989.

South Africa ranks 96th of 192 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 63 years of available data.

Daily per capita fat supply vs. GDP per capita in South Africa, year by year

Annual values for Daily per capita fat supply vs. GDP per capita in South Africa, 1961 to 2023.
Year grams of fat per day per capita Change
1961 63.9 grams of fat per day per capita
1962 63 grams of fat per day per capita -1.4%
1963 63.84 grams of fat per day per capita +1.3%
1964 63.65 grams of fat per day per capita -0.3%
1965 67.74 grams of fat per day per capita +6.4%
1966 65.48 grams of fat per day per capita -3.3%
1967 65.82 grams of fat per day per capita +0.5%
1968 66.8 grams of fat per day per capita +1.5%
1969 66.92 grams of fat per day per capita +0.2%
1970 65.71 grams of fat per day per capita -1.8%
1971 64.69 grams of fat per day per capita -1.6%
1972 65.7 grams of fat per day per capita +1.6%
1973 69.68 grams of fat per day per capita +6.1%
1974 65.68 grams of fat per day per capita -5.7%
1975 64.54 grams of fat per day per capita -1.7%
1976 63.89 grams of fat per day per capita -1.0%
1977 62.68 grams of fat per day per capita -1.9%
1978 62.14 grams of fat per day per capita -0.9%
1979 62.08 grams of fat per day per capita -0.1%
1980 62.68 grams of fat per day per capita +1.0%
1981 62.32 grams of fat per day per capita -0.6%
1982 62.32 grams of fat per day per capita -0.0%
1983 63.51 grams of fat per day per capita +1.9%
1984 62.77 grams of fat per day per capita -1.2%
1985 63.84 grams of fat per day per capita +1.7%
1986 62.68 grams of fat per day per capita -1.8%
1987 64.77 grams of fat per day per capita +3.3%
1988 60.84 grams of fat per day per capita -6.1%
1989 59.14 grams of fat per day per capita -2.8%
1990 60.17 grams of fat per day per capita +1.8%
1991 60.39 grams of fat per day per capita +0.4%
1992 60.12 grams of fat per day per capita -0.5%
1993 59.9 grams of fat per day per capita -0.4%
1994 63.89 grams of fat per day per capita +6.7%
1995 65.37 grams of fat per day per capita +2.3%
1996 64 grams of fat per day per capita -2.1%
1997 67.17 grams of fat per day per capita +4.9%
1998 67.89 grams of fat per day per capita +1.1%
1999 66.17 grams of fat per day per capita -2.5%
2000 67.76 grams of fat per day per capita +2.4%
2001 71.97 grams of fat per day per capita +6.2%
2002 74.85 grams of fat per day per capita +4.0%
2003 76.35 grams of fat per day per capita +2.0%
2004 75.96 grams of fat per day per capita -0.5%
2005 78.25 grams of fat per day per capita +3.0%
2006 78.69 grams of fat per day per capita +0.6%
2007 77.93 grams of fat per day per capita -1.0%
2008 81.95 grams of fat per day per capita +5.2%
2009 85.63 grams of fat per day per capita +4.5%
2010 86.91 grams of fat per day per capita +1.5%
2011 85.93 grams of fat per day per capita -1.1%
2012 88.76 grams of fat per day per capita +3.3%
2013 87.94 grams of fat per day per capita -0.9%
2014 83.59 grams of fat per day per capita -4.9%
2015 83.52 grams of fat per day per capita -0.1%
2016 85.51 grams of fat per day per capita +2.4%
2017 86.47 grams of fat per day per capita +1.1%
2018 85.13 grams of fat per day per capita -1.5%
2019 88.76 grams of fat per day per capita +4.3%
2020 96.15 grams of fat per day per capita +8.3%
2021 93.67 grams of fat per day per capita -2.6%
2022 99.65 grams of fat per day per capita +6.4%
2023 95.57 grams of fat per day per capita -4.1%

Quantity that is available for consumption at the end of the supply chain. It does not account for consumer waste, so the quantity that is actually consumed may be lower. This is the total of all agricultural produce, both crops and livestock.
